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30937099654 59 1390035927
5228823638 6470754 435403
5228823638 6470754 435403
77773658403 7009517 94997642621
All about undefined
Interested in learning more?
5228823638 6470754 435403
77773658403 7009517 94997642621
See more
67423 7421028984 40
054 49046794 07977 015808
See more
33103006636 1387
38631741 97126 65 8890748
See more